Abstract
The therapeutic potential of erythropoietin gains increasing attention amon g radiation oncologists because the prognosis is better for patients with h igh blood hemoglobin levels following radiotherapy. However, there is still a debate on how hemoglobin affects radiotherapy. Further, the means to man ipulate the hemoglobin level, their indication and administration need to b e clarified. Available experimental and clinical data on hypoxia, anemia an d on their treatment with erythropoietin have been extensively discussed at an international conference in Freiburg, Germany, in June 1999.
